Transaction 04576fa7cb884b4172801ae94729c254aff82efd7a2753a6df04e6cf9d45ea40
1 Input
1 Output
-
04576fa7cb884b4172801ae94729c254aff82efd7a2753a6df04e6cf9d45ea40:0
- value
- 18716450
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ac138badd95d6aff2658babe28948876f8ed5a
- address
- bc1q2xkp8zadm9wk4lextzatu2y53pm03m266z5avk